Reduced Cone Density Is Associated with Multiple Sclerosis.

Abstract

PURPOSE

Multiple sclerosis (MS) is an inflammatory neurodegenerative disease of the central nervous system. Recent evidence suggests that degeneration of the inner layers of the retina occurs in MS. This study aimed to examine whether there are outer retinal changes in patients living with MS.

DESIGN

This was a single center, cross-sectional study.

PARTICIPANTS

Sixteen patients with MS and 25 controls (volunteers without diagnosed MS) were recruited for the study.

METHODS

We acquired volumetric spectral domain-OCT scans of the macula and a circular scan around the optic nerve head (ONH). We also captured adaptive optics (AO) images at 0° (centered on the foveola), 2°, 4°, and 6° temporal to the fovea.

MAIN OUTCOME MEASURES

We calculated the thickness of the different retinal layers in the macula and around the ONH using the inbuilt software of the OCT. We evaluated changes in cone photoreceptors by calculating cone density and spacing by the inbuilt AO automatic segmentation algorithm with manual correction. We compared patients with and without optic neuritis and controls.

RESULTS

We found significant thinning of the inner retina and a thickening of the outer retina in the eye with a history of optic neuritis (eyes of patients with MS with a history of optic neuritis; mean difference [MD]: -11.13 ± 3.61 μm,  = 0.002 and MD: 2.86 ± 0.89 μm,  = 0.001; respectively). We did not observe changes in retinal layers without optic neuritis in eyes of patients with MS without a history of optic neuritis. However, regional differences were detected in the peripapillary retinal nerve fiber layer. Analyzing AO images revealed a significantly lower cone outer-segment density at all eccentricities in all patients compared with control eyes ( < 0.05), independent of optic neuritis history.

CONCLUSIONS

Our results showed that all MS cases were associated with decreased cone densities. Future longitudinal studies will help to elucidate whether this is a specific and sensitive method to detect and monitor the development and progression of MS.

摘要

目的

多发性硬化症(MS)是一种中枢神经系统的炎性神经退行性疾病。最近的证据表明,MS患者会出现视网膜内层的退化。本研究旨在检查MS患者是否存在视网膜外层变化。

设计

这是一项单中心横断面研究。

参与者

招募了16例MS患者和25名对照者(未诊断为MS的志愿者)参与本研究。

方法

我们获取了黄斑区的容积光谱域光学相干断层扫描(SD-OCT)图像以及视神经乳头(ONH)周围的环形扫描图像。我们还在0°(以中央凹为中心)、2°、4°和6°颞侧中央凹处采集了自适应光学(AO)图像。

主要观察指标

我们使用OCT的内置软件计算黄斑区和ONH周围不同视网膜层的厚度。我们通过内置的AO自动分割算法并进行手动校正来计算视锥细胞密度和间距,从而评估视锥细胞光感受器的变化。我们比较了有和没有视神经炎的患者以及对照者。

结果

我们发现有视神经炎病史的眼睛中,视网膜内层显著变薄,外层增厚(有视神经炎病史的MS患者的眼睛;平均差值[MD]:-11.13±3.61μm,P = 0.002;MD:2.86±0.89μm,P = 0.001)。在没有视神经炎病史的MS患者的眼睛中,我们未观察到视网膜层的变化。然而,在视乳头周围视网膜神经纤维层检测到了区域差异。分析AO图像发现,与对照眼相比,所有患者在所有偏心度下视锥细胞外节密度均显著降低(P < 0.05),与视神经炎病史无关。

结论

我们的结果表明,所有MS病例均与视锥细胞密度降低有关。未来的纵向研究将有助于阐明这是否是检测和监测MS发生发展的一种特异性和敏感性方法。
